site stats

Simplified instructional computer in verilog

WebbVerilog Equality Operators. Equality operators have the same precedence amongst them and are lower in precedence than relational operators. The result is 1 if true, and 0 if … WebbStep 6: Programming. It is time to “manufacture” your first integrated circuit — no need for a manufacturing plant. Manufacturing an IC with an FPGA (“programming an FPGA”) is …

Verilog basics - a SIMPLE Verilog module - an inverter - YouTube

Webb2.Verilog Modeling: Synthesizable vs. Non-Synthesizable RTL Verilog is a powerful language that was originally intended for building simulators of hardware as opposed to … WebbAnswer (1 of 3): A simple starting point would be to divide your processor into conceivable blocks; small enough that it can be tested easily enough but not so small as to create … early bird sports expo bloomsburg https://internet-strategies-llc.com

Zilog Z80 - Wikipedia

Webb8 jan. 2024 · IR — INSTRUCTION REGISTER The Instruction register is 8 bit wide and it stores the instruction fetched from the IRAM. PC ... This is selected by the first 4 bits of … WebbIn this lab, we will build a tiny computer in Verilog. The execution results will be displayed in the HEX[3:0] of your board. Unlike a real computer, our tiny computer will consist of … Webb18 mars 2024 · Verilog makes use of the conditional operator in order to build tri-state buffers and multiplexers. Let’s see how the conditional operator can be used practically. … early bird sportsman show bloomsburg pa

Woody Chang - Hardware / Software Engineer

Category:How to Write a Basic Module in SystemVerilog - FPGA …

Tags:Simplified instructional computer in verilog

Simplified instructional computer in verilog

How to code a far absolute JMP/CALL instruction in MASM?

Webbborrowing from your friends to admittance them. This is an totally simple means to specifically acquire lead by on-line. This online notice The Cisco Ios Router Alley Pdf Pdf can be one of the options to accompany you later than having further time. It will not waste your time. agree to me, the e-book will agreed melody you additional issue to ... WebbCoverage includes: Digital circuits at the gate and flip-flop levels Analysis and design of combinational and sequentialcircuits Microcomputer organization, architecture, and programmingconcepts Design of computer instruction sets, CPU, memory, and I/O System design features associated with popular microprocessorsfrom Intel and Motorola Future …

Simplified instructional computer in verilog

Did you know?

WebbAbstract -The RISC or Reduced Instruction Set Computer is a design philosophy that has become a mainstream in ... The processor has been designed with Verilog HDL, … http://classweb.ece.umd.edu/enee446/p1.pdf

WebbEngineering; Electrical Engineering; Electrical Engineering questions and answers; Say I have a fully functional simple computer written in Verilog, that takes in instructions and … Webb17 juli 2024 · Verilog is a Hardware Description Language (HDL) which can be used to describe digital circuits in a textual manner. We will write our design for FPGA using …

Webb30 juli 2024 · From the ISA, we know this system requires a 4x16-bit register file (r0-r3) and register for pc (program counter), a simple ALU (Arithmetic Logic Unit, in our case it can only add) with Zero status register (Z flag) and a bunch of combinational logic to tie to all together (for decoding the instructions, determining the next value of pc, etc). WebbMy friend and I successfully used Verilog to build a Turing Complete, simple “Reduced Instruction Set Computer” (RISC), which can operand …

Webb30 jan. 2015 · 4,139. This code seems to be incomplete, since neither address nor Branch1 are used in the code. But in brief, * If the jump control signal is high, the value of the …

Webb#SimplifiedInstructionalComputerArchitecture#DJSpecIn this video, we study about the Simplified Instructional Computer (SIC/XE) Architecture, with example i... css usea1wtrans1.infor.comWebb8-bit computer in Verilog This project contains: a 8-bit CPU with a basic instruction set 256 bytes of RAM How to use it Build an exemple: ./asm/asm.py tests/multiplication.asm > … early birds rochedaleWebb11 apr. 2024 · There’s one way you can do it, but you need to use MASM’s /omf switch so that it generates object files in the OMF format. This means the object files need to be linked with an OMF compatible linker, like Microsoft’s old segmented linker (and not their current 32-bit linker.) earlybirds sanda universityWebb* Digital Desing Engineer with 3+ years of hands-on experience using tools Cadence Virtuoso, Xilinx spartan 3A, Quartus prime * Awarded M.S and … css usccb.orgWebb2 apr. 2016 · Verilog Program Counter with branching. I need to create a Verilog module which accepts the clock, a reset, the immediate value from the instruction word (least … css use border to create squre list styleWebbWIDE RANGE OF GRAPHICS DEVICES RANGING FROM SIMPLE FRAME BUFFERS TO FULLY HARDWARE ACCELERATED' 'RISC IP eSi RISC Configurable Soft Processor Core April 21st, 2024 - The eSi RISC is implemented as a soft IP core based on synthesisable Verilog RTL and can be easily ported to a wide range of ASIC processes and FPGAs' 'cs … early birds programs companiesWebbVerilog code for 16-bit single cycle MIPS processor. In this project, a 16-bit single-cycle MIPS processor is implemented in Verilog HDL. MIPS is an RISC processor, which is widely used by many universities in academic … css usaf